Local Fire Bans

Local Fire Bans are currently in place for the Gladstone Regional and surrounding areas. Council's Parks & Recreation Department have taken the precaution and have removed all firewood from all wood fired barbeques.

 

This includes wood firedbarbeques at Canoe Point, Millennium Esplanade and Parks in Calliope, Miriam Vale Agnes Water and Seventeen Seventy Area. Electric BBQ's are still available in most Council parks, and their use is still permitted during the fire ban, provided they are not left unattended.

 

Strictly NO CAMPFIRE's allowed at Calliope River Camping Grounds or any other camping grounds until the Fire bans are cancelled.

 

Firewood will be returned to Council wood fired barbeques once it is safe to do so.
